Making a Difference

Communities In Schools is one of the most effective dropout prevention strategies in the country, and we’ve been named one of the 100 non-profit organizations most likely to change the world by Worth magazine. With support from the community and key partnering agencies, we’ve been helping millions of young people stay in school and prepare for life for the past 30 years.


We believe that each child needs and deserves:

• A one on one relationship with a caring adult

• A safe place to learn and grow

• A healthy start and a healthy future

• A marketable skill to use upon graduation

• A chance to give back to peers and the community


CIS creates special initiatives to directly address specific factors that contribute to the dropout crisis. These initiatives are designed to be long-term, sustainable programs that are funded by donations and grants and are free to students and their families. By creating a support network of volunteers, social services, business and community resources; and integrating these resources and initiatives into the school, students and families can easily take advantage of them.


Our results on a national level speak volumes for what we do.

We are an outcomes based organization that tracks and monitors our programs closely as we deliver key services that make a positive improvement in the lives of our children. Over the past year, we’ve been able to accomplish change through our national network.


97% of CIS students remained in school
88% of CIS students were promoted to the next grade
86% of CIS students showed improvement in their behavior
83% of CIS high school seniors at risk for dropping out graduated
79% of CIS students showed improvement in academic achievement
76% of CIS students improved their attendance
68% of CIS students went on to various forms of post-secondary education

Effective Change in the Silver State

Nevada has one of the highest dropout rates in the Nation.  In fact, according to the Nevada Department of Education, 114 students drop out of school every instructional day. Communities In Schools of Nevada has been working to stop the clock on our dropout crisis in Nevada since 2003. We are the leading champion of connecting needed community resources to help meet students’ basic needs and provide them with the necessary tools for staying in school and preparing for their future. We currently serve over 23 locations including elementary schools, middle schools, combined schools (k-12), 1 high school and one community based site reaching over 16,000 children in Southern Nevada and work with nearly 10,000 children in our Northeastern Nevada region. Last year alone we coordinated nearly $850,000 worth of services.


Our Mission:

Our mission is simple. To champion the connection of needed community resources with schools to help young people successfully learn, stay in school and prepare for life.
